WebFor S-speed-rated tires, it's 112 mph; for T, 118 mph. Speed ratings for other tires include Q, 99 mph; H, 130 mph; and V , 149 mph. Some tires have speed ratings of W, 168 mph and Y, 186 mph. WebA T rating indicates the tire is approved for speeds up to 118 mph (190 km/h) under optimal conditions. T ratings are most associated with standard touring tires, and everyday passenger vehicles like family sedans and minivans. H An H speed rating indicates the tire is approved for speeds up to 130 mph (210 km/h) under optimal conditions.

WebWhat Is the Speed Rating on a Tire? The tire speed rating is the maximum speed tires can safely carry a load (the original weight of your vehicle plus whatever’s in it) for a sustained amount of time in ideal conditions. The speed rating sits alongside the load index on the side of every tire.

WebAug 11, 2024 · T Speed Rating: This rating means that the tire can safely maintain a speed of 118mph over a long period of time.
